NIKE BASKETBALL ELITE SERIES 2.0 | A VISUAL BREAKDOWN

 photo BANNER_zps9d57d3a2.jpg
The Nike Basketball Elite Series is the very pinnacle of basketball footwear performance and design. Returning in this year's Nike Elite line-up are LeBron with his LeBron X PS Elite and Kobe with his Zoom Kobe 8 Elite. Joining the squad is KD with his improved KD V Elite - lower, faster, and more versatile than ever.

INTRODUCING: THE NIKE KD V

Photobucket
From the mind of Leo Chang comes Kevin Durant's fifth signature shoe - The KD V. It is Kevin Durant's heart and soul manifested in a shoe; it's design is the most honest and pure yet.

The Nike KD line, in my opinion, has become the most genuine and conceptually rich among the footwear franchises today. The V just proves my point.

The depth of the concept is remarkable. Still present are the minute details that tell KD's history, a tapestry of symbols that represent his deep and unwavering love for his family and hometown. But completely unique to this model is the incorporation of the numeric symbol "V" and the pentagon. Symbolizing his fifth shoe, the "V" is also a representation of the "team" - five men on the court aiming for victory. On the other hand, the Pentagon is a literal symbolism of The Pentagon, the military landmark in his hometown Washington, D.C.

The KD V is a truly inspired piece of art. Yes, I said ART. It looks like art, and I'm sure it performs like one, too. This partnership of Leo Chang and KD will go down in Nike Basketball's 20 year history as one of the most exciting and inspiring footwear lineages to ever grace the hardwood.

MAY THE 4TH BE WITH YOU /// NIKE ZOOM KD IV



Photobucket
I'm sure you've heard... The almost-lost NBA Season is set to return this Christmas! Though we all look forward to seeing Kobe's fadaway and LeBron's fading hairline, let's take this moment to bask in the glory of the Lockout MVP: Kevin Durant.

The man that's been on a tear since his Tour of China and his showstopping stint in Smart's Ultimate All-Star Weekend has been seen rocking his trusty Nike Zoom KD IIIs day in and day out in a series of colorways... All of that is about to change.

Starting this December, a new KD will usher in the new NBA season... It's latest incarnation: 
The Nike Zoom KD IV.

Photobucket

It features the new Adaptive Fit system, Hyperfuse construction and a Zoom Air unit – a versatile combination for one of basketball’s most electric players.

The Nike Zoom KD IV was built to the exact specifications of Durant, who is closely involved in the design process with Nike Basketball Footwear Design Director Leo Chang.  Chang has led the design for all four of Durant’s Nike signature shoes since 2008. Incorporated for the first time in a basketball shoe, the new Adaptive Fit system provides a lock-down fit with a synthetic strap that wraps up from the inside of the upper and integrates with the laces for superior fit and lateral support.

Photobucket


The Hyperfuse construction on the upper is a composite of three different layers of material that are fused together using a pressing process to create a nearly seamless, one-piece upper that is lightweight, breathable and durable. Furthermore, the Nike Zoom unit in the forefoot provides lightweight, low-profile and responsive cushioning. Lastly, a low collar design provides optimal support and flexibility through the ankle and makes this a versatile shoe for multiple positions on the court.



As Kevin evolves as a basketball player so do his shoes.
“First and foremost my shoe needs to be comfortable - it felt like I had been playing with them the whole season. The Adaptive Fit system is a customized feel and locks me in,” said Durant. 
Photobucket
 
Designed with direct insights from Kevin Durant and his lineage, the Nike Zoom KD IV pays tribute to his team and family with details incorporated into the outsole including a lightning bolt traction pattern representing KD’s team and “Big Chucky” on the heel which pays tribute to KD’s late childhood mentor and coach. The initials “WP” in the shape of a heart on each toe represent Kevin’s parents and “Barbara” is his grandmother’s name. Personal messages as “Work Hard” and “Stay Focused” are printed also on the outsole.

Get your head out of that lockout funk! Celebrate by copping yourself The Scoring Champ's new weapon of choice!

The Nike Zoom KD IV launches on December 1, 2011 in select Nike stores nationwide and will retail at Php4,795.00.
